Subject: Possible acquisition — keep it quiet for now

Branch managers,

Wanted you to hear this from us first: we're in early talks to acquire Quellan Ridge Logistics. If it goes through, it would roughly double our delivery footprint in the western corridor and finally give the Harlew branches proper warehousing. Nothing is signed, so please don't mention it to staff or customers yet. Business as usual until we say otherwise. Details on where this fits our plans are in the confidential note below.

Cheers,
Ronan

management briefing: Project Ulavan slips by two quarters because of the staffing delay.

Subject: Hermetic build cut-over — we made it

Hi support folks, quick wrap-up: the Fernbuckle build moved off the old shared-toolchain setup and onto Sealcrate, our hermetic build system, as of last night. Builds are now fully reproducible, so "works on my machine" tickets should drop off a cliff. Caches were warmed over the weekend, so build times look normal. If a customer reports odd artifacts, first check that their pipeline is using the following configuration values.

config for kafof-bawef:
holath:
  log_level: debug
  metrics_host: metrics.holath.qorvelsys.internal
  pin: 2191
  pool_size: 32

Welcome to on-call for Fernbus!

Our event schema registry (Canopy) gates every producer deploy — if Canopy's down, deploys stall, so it pages loudly. Schemas are versioned, backward-compat enforced; overrides need two approvals. Most incidents are just a stuck validator pod — restart it first. If you need the break-glass admin account, unlock it with the passphrase below.

unlock words, hahip-baduf: holwyn-istath-julvan

## Deployment

The Coldgate archiver moves buckets untouched for 180 days into glacier tier. Deploy via the standard pipeline; no manual steps. Dry-run mode is on by default in every environment except prod-archive. Never run two archiver instances against the same region — the lock is advisory only. Current production configuration follows.

service settings:
PRAWYN_PIN=9848
PRAWYN_METRICS_HOST=metrics.prawyn.lumicworks.corp
PRAWYN_LOG_LEVEL=warn
PRAWYN_TENANT=pelius